Sculptra is a bio-stimulating injectable made from poly-L-lactic acid (PLLA), a synthetic compound that has been safely used in medical applications for decades. When administered as Sculptra injections, it works beneath the skin’s surface to support collagen regeneration. As new collagen forms, treated areas gain long-lasting volume and structural support.

What Concerns does Sculpture Injection Treat?
Sculptra is used to correct age-related volume loss in areas such as the cheeks, temples, and mid-face, as well as hollowing under the eyes and reduced facial support. It also helps improve deep creases, skin laxity, and structural imbalance in the lower face and jaw. When used for different parts of the body, Sculptra helps with issues such as wrinkles, sagging, cellulite, and hip dips, improving the skin’s underlying structure. Unlike traditional fillers, Sculptra works gradually by stimulating the body’s natural collagen, creating balanced support without an overfilled appearance.

The Treatment Experience
Consultation & Assessment
Your specialist reviews your goals, facial volume distribution, and medical history to plan a tailored injection strategy.
Cleansing & Preparation
The skin is cleansed and prepared to maintain a sterile treatment environment.
Sculptra Injections
Sculptra Filler is injected into targeted areas using precise techniques to ensure even distribution.
Molding & Evaluation
The clinician gently shapes and assesses the placement to optimize long-term results.
Post-Treatment Planning
A follow-up schedule is established to monitor progress and ensure collagen stimulation continues effectively.
Sculptra sessions usually last 20–45 minutes, depending on the number of areas treated

How many sessions are typically needed?
Most patients require 2–4 sessions spaced several weeks apart, depending on the degree of volume loss and treatment goals.
When will I see results?
Initial results may appear within a few weeks, but full results typically manifest over 2–3 months as collagen forms.
Is Sculptra painful?
A topical anesthetic or local numbing agent is often used. Discomfort is generally mild and well-tolerated.
How long do results last?
Results from Sculptra Treatment in Ras Al Khaimah can last up to 2 years in many cases, due to prolonged collagen support.
Are there any side effects?
Temporary swelling, redness, or small bumps at injection sites may occur and usually resolve without intervention. Serious complications are rare when administered by a trained specialist.
